Zach LaVine
Zach LaVine

Zach LaVine is an explosive shooting guard who plays for the Chicago Bulls. Born on March 10, 1995, LaVine is known for his athleticism and highlight-reel plays.

Hailing from Renton, Washington, LaVine was recognized as a five-star athlete at Bothell High School and spent a season at UCLA before entering the NBA. It was evident that he possessed a rare combination of athleticism and shooting ability that would soon make waves on the NBA stage.

Drafted 13th overall by the Minnesota Timberwolves in 2014, LaVine quickly gained fame for his insane gravity-defying dunks. He eventually participated in the 2015 NBA All-Star Weekend’s Slam Dunk Contest and ended up winning it.

Next season, LaVine faced Aaron Gordon in a historic 2016 Slam Dunk Contest, which had some truly jaw-dropping memorable dunks. He ended up winning the Slam Dunk contest yet again in 2016, becoming only the fourth NBA player ever to win consecutive Slam Dunk Contests.

Traded to the Bulls in 2017, LaVine elevated his game to All-star level as he displayed improved shooting and established himself as a knockdown off-the-ball shooter. He soon became Bulls’ franchise player and earned two NBA All-Star nods in 2021 and 2022. He has the second-most 40-point games in Bulls history after the legendary Michael Jordan.

In the 2022-2023 season, he had impressive averages of 24.8 points, 4.5 rebounds, and 4.2 assists per game.

Zach LaVine Contract Breakdown

YearBase SalarySigningBonusCap HitDead CapYearly Cash
2023-24 $40,064,220-$40,064,220-$40,064,220
2024-25$43,031,940-$43,031,940-$43,031,940
2025-26$45,999,660-$45,999,660-$45,999,660
2026-27(PlayerOption)$48,967,380-$48,967,380-$48,967,380

How much is Zach LaVine getting paid?

Zach LaVine is set to earn $40,064,220 for the 2023/24 NBA season.

According to Sportrac, he agreed to a five year contract with the Chicago Bulls, worth a whopping $215,159,700 guaranteed, an average annual salary of $43,031,940.

Zach LaVine Career Earnings

After the end of the 2023/24 season, LaVine would have earned over $163 million from his NBA contracts.

What are the terms of Zach LaVine’s contract?

Zach LaVine’s current contract has a player option at the end of 2025/26 season. He can either opt in for 2026/27 or opt out.

How much of the Zach LaVine Contract is guaranteed?

Zach LaVine’s entire $215,159,700 is guaranteed, an average annual salary of $43,031,940.

Zach LaVine Contract History

These are all the contracts that Zach LaVine has signed in his career till now.

July 8, 2014

Zach LaVine signed a two-year $4.2 million rookie contract with the Minnesota Timberwolves.

July 8, 2018

Zach LaVine agreed to sign a four-year $78 million contract with the Chicago Bulls.

July 7, 2022

LaVine signed a five year, $215.16 million contract with the Chicago Bulls.
